Nc programming examples pdf free download

The one that i cut from styrofoam is about 4 inches 100mm in size which makes the arrow shaft very thin. All cnc lathe programming pdf free download cnc turning drawing examples pdf download cnc turning programming cnc programming examples with. Simple cnc gcode programming software for 3 axis cnc. Depending upon the current dfa state, pass the character to an appropriate statehandling function. Improve cnc productivity with parametric programming. Make g code for your 3 axis cnc mill the easy way with simple cnc. Web to pdfconvert any web pages to highquality pdf. Fundamentals this fundamentals programming manual is intended for use by skilled machine operators with the appropriate expertise in drilling, milling and turning operations. G02 g03 example cnc mill cnc part program g0 x30 y30 p1 g1 y22. Nc part programming examples pdf nc part programming examples pdf download. Nowadays, these are is not required mostly point to point programming simple complicated configuration of the path calculations with the help of a computer. Learn to read and write gcode in this 16 chapter tutorial course. Pointtopoint or continuous path cnc programming falls into two distinct categories fig.

The term numerical control is a widely accepted and commonly used term in the machine tool industry. The position of the tool is described by using a cartesian coordinate system. Pdf download cnc programming handbook by peter smid. Download conceptdraw pro free 21 trial for mac and pc. Here you will find plenty of free cnc programming examples with component drawings. Top 4 download periodically updates software information of cnc g code full versions from the publishers, but some information may be slightly outofdate using warez version, crack, warez passwords, patches, serial numbers, registration codes, key generator, pirate key, keymaker or keygen for cnc g code license key is illegal. The second chapter focuses on introduction c programming. Software trusted by engineers at nasa, tesla, and over 15,000 cncers worldwide. Sample introduction to cnc cnc from wikipedia, the free encyclopedia the abbreviation cnc stands for computer numerical control, and refers speci. Cadcam software for 2d and 3d cnc machine programming. Cnc mill example program cnc program n40 g90 g00 x0 y0 n50 g01 g02 g03 circular interpolation cnc mill example program. Lyndexnikken mazak multiplex static live tooling catalog. General information, type of dnc systems, hardware components.

Six key concepts needed to master cnc programming mike lynch cnc concepts, inc. A part program is simply an nc program used to manufacture a part. So if youre a developer or tester and want to check the functionalities of your app or demo, just download this free pdf file. The description of the nc programming is divided into two manuals. Ncplot and cimco edit are two useful tools that can assist you in your study of macro programming. In absolute programming, the g90 command indicates to the computer and mcu that the programming is in the absolute mode. This is free app will teach you that how to use a cnc programming example. The part programmer must have a knowledge of machining or other processing technology for which the nc machine is designed as well as geometry and trigonometry.

The system must automatically interpret at least some portion of this data. Easier to learn and faster to use then writing it by hand or using a cadcam programs. C programming examples free download i supplement each tutorial with a number of c programming examples. I wish to write the nc part program and the precursor apt code for a congruent toolpath which is a magnification by 4, translation by 22. Run the program, using extra caution until the program is proven to be error. Nc which quickly became computer numerical control cnc has brought tremendous changes to the metalworking industry. Simple cnc gcode programming software for 3 axis cnc machining. The book is has been replaced by the cnc programming. Function comment examples bad main function comment read a character from stdin. Cnc g code software free download cnc g code top 4 download. The basic cnc programming and the difference between absolute programming mode and incremental programming mode is explained in this tutorial for.

The same part can be reproduced to the same degree. Cncgcode free dxf shape files for cnc cutting cncgcode. The third chapter provides with detailed program on next level to the basic c program. Feb 27, 2020 cnc programming example cnc tools cnc programming example cnc tools is a free application for the cnc technology. Save time by viewing the mazatrol program file at your desk instead of on the mazak control in the workshop. Aug 03, 2017 nc plot and cimco edit are two useful tools that can assist you in your study of macro programming. As great as the world wide web is, sometimes its nice to have pdf s that you can download, print, and hold in your hand. Requiring the simulator at and looking at the cncsimulator. Nc part programming examples pdf hurco manufacturing company reserves the right to. Portable document format pdf is a file format used to present and exchange documents reliably, independent of software, hardware, or operating system.

A cnc mill program for cnc machinists programmers, who have started to learning basic cnc programming techniques. Simple programming examples are used to explain the commands and statements which are. Write the part program in a standard format special manuscript and flexo writer tape, listing etc. Apr 20, 2018 cadcam software has everything to do with modern cnc machine programming and plays a critical role in the future success of manufacturing at a global level. Cadcam software has everything to do with modern cnc machine programming and plays a critical role in the future success of manufacturing at a global level. Netcat is a platform independent command supported by linux, unix, windows, bsd, macos, etc.

Sinumerik cnc training software siemens sinutrain free download. Cnc programming example app will help you to learn cnc programmed easily with practical example. Cnc programming example cnc tools cnc programming example cnc tools is a free application for the cnc technology. An introduction to the c programming language and software design pdf 158p this note covers the following topics. Looking for cnc programming, cnc machine programming, cnc gcodes, or examples in pdf form to download and study. Recommended by mazak, cimco mazatrol viewer for cimco edit is the easiest and most cost effective way to view mazatrol files at your pc. This is known as prompt message and appears on the screen like enter an integer number. Sinumerik 840d sl 828d 5 fundamentals 6 7 8 9 10 11 12. The first executable statement in the program is a. This ebook is the best for beginner because there are step by step procedure to learn c programming language. Learning fanuc custom macro b programming with ncplot and.

Need a quick and easy gcode tutorial or gcode course. If so, youre in the right place with the cnccookbook cnc gcode course. The zip file includes a dxf file, a gcode nc file, and the picture. Nc part programming nc part programming consists of planning and documenting the sequence of processing steps to be performed on an nc machine. If 0,0,0 position can be described by the operator, then it is called floating zero. This cnc programming example explains the cnc boring with cnc boring bar tool. Compilers the examples included in this tutorial are all console programs. Now, however, most control units are able to handle both pointto.

Numerical control nc enables an operator to communicate with machine tools through a series of numbers and symbols. Sinumerik 840d sl 828d 5 fundamentals 6 7 8 9 10 11 12 a. Its use is intended only as an aid in the operation of the haas milling machine. Cnc programming for beginners a cnc programming example. Know your machine from a programmers viewpoint o machine configurations.

The information in this workbook may apply in whole or in part to the operation of other cnc machines. A good news for the cnc programmers cnc machinist who work on sinumerik or just starting to learn or for those who want to polish their cnc programming skills on sinumerik cnc control, that sinutrain the cnc training software for the siemens sinumerik 840d sinumerik 828d cnc control is available for free download, this is a trialversion. Manufacturers are continuously looking for solutions to improving cnc automation that is efficient, safe and takes the most profitable route to making parts. I encourage you to get one if yours is not adapted. Cnc programming using fanuc custom macro b pdf cnc manual. C programming ebook pdf free download, basic knowledge of c in starting. Fundamentals of cnc machining titans of cnc academy. The difference between the two categories was once very distinct.

Agenda introduction absolute and incremental programming elements of nc program nc words g, m, t, s, codes examples cutter compensation and offsets examples conclusions 35. Our very best free educational resources to help you become a better cncer. This programming manual is meant as a supplementary teaching aid to users of the haas mill. Download various types of cnc files for free including. Fundamentals the fundamentals programming manual is intended for use by skilled machine operators with the appropriate expertise in drilling, milling and turning operations. Netcat is a simple but useful tool used for tcp, udp, unixdomain sockets. Download any of the product titles below and install to either update your software or install for first time evaluation. This computer numerical control notes pdf cnc pdf notesfree download book starts with the topics covering fundamentais of numerical control, machine structure guide ways, interchangeable tooling system, computeaided programming. As great as the world wide web is, sometimes its nice to have pdfs that you can download, print, and hold in your hand. These physics principles will determine the design of tools being used. Sep 25, 2019 pdf download cnc programming handbook by peter smid free epub. Computer numerical control pdf notes cnc notes pdf sw. Netcat can listen or connect specified sockets easily.

Cnc programming pdfs easy download and print cnccookbook. Cnc programming pdfs easy download and print looking for cnc programming cnc machine programming cnc g codes or examples in pdf form to download and study. See more ideas about cnc programming, cnc machine and cnc. Manual part programming types of manual programming. As the webs leading information source for cncers, we. If you make one much smaller, make sure your machine has the accuracy to cut it properly. Before c, high level languages were criticized by machine code programmers because they shielded the user from the working details of the computer. With over 5 million visits a year, cnccookbook is the leading cnc blog on the internet. Use pdf download to do whatever you like with pdf files on the web and regain control. This computer numerical control notes pdf cnc pdf notes free download book starts with the topics covering fundamentais of numerical control, machine structure guide ways, interchangeable tooling system, computeaided programming. This book has basic information about milling programming. In nc programming, it is always assumed that the tool moves relative to the workpiece no matter what the real situation is. Its free, its easy, and its chock full of good information. Improve cnc productivity with parametric programming mike lynch cnc concepts, inc.

Jul 10, 20 agenda introduction absolute and incremental programming elements of nc program nc words g, m, t, s, codes examples cutter compensation and offsets examples conclusions 35. The value returned by the statehandling function is the next dfa state. Downloads we offer all of our software products for a risk free trial to ensure compatibility and satisfaction prior to purchase. Computer numeric control a system in which actions are controlled by the direct insertion of numerical data at some point. Introduction to nc programming manual part programming computerassisted part programming formats fixedaddress tab. Today, typical turnaround time for new nc programs is measured in minutes. Virtual user interface for industrial robots offline programming. Learn what it takes to master gcode level cnc programming. Here is a cnc programming example for beginners, this cnc programming example is a starting step for cnc learning or cnc programming for beginners. A quick overview of what gcode is and some basic informaion. Included in nearly every article are examples using our cnc programming software, gwizard editor. Nowadays, these are is not required mostly point to point programming simple.

Display programs in a familiar format to avoid making mistakes. Maybe you just want to learn more about a specific gcode related topic or see particular gcode examples. The first chapter deals with the fundamental concepts of c language. Lathe, user guide, cnc machine, selca, reading online, manual, pdf, free. Download the cnc program from your computer to the machine control using rs. When the shop upgraded its nc programming capability by moving to a new cam system last year, it was looking for ways to ease, if not eliminate, this nc programming bottleneck.